Main Duties
- Performs original design work utilizing specifications, sketches and ideas on developing designs.
- Analyzes space utilization effectiveness and changing demands for space needs: recommends actions to meet new requirements.
- Assists in compiling data for architectural plans, specifications, cost estimates, reports, etc.
- Meet with other departments to determine requirements of projects.
- Assists in the preparation for plans for existing buildings where plans are not available.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
- Assists in conducting preliminary studies of proposed projects to obtain information as to space and design requirements, obtaining measurements and making sketches preliminary to the preparation of drawing.
- Reliable and well-organized.
- Assists in preparation of scale drawing of details required for contract drawing.
- Assists in preparation of layout and draws preliminary sketch of project to present to client.
- Assists in developing and/or coordinating development of detailed working drawings and specifications after approval for project has been obtained.
- Reviews work of contractor, verifying specified materials are being used, dimensions are as drawn and quality is according to contract document.
